 * SECTION:gtkstylecontext
 | 
						||
 * @Short_description: Rendering UI elements
 | 
						||
 * @Title: GtkStyleContext
 | 
						||
 *
 | 
						||
 * #GtkStyleContext is an object that stores styling information affecting
 | 
						||
 * a widget defined by #GtkWidgetPath.
 | 
						||
 *
 | 
						||
 * In order to construct the final style information, #GtkStyleContext
 | 
						||
 * queries information from all attached #GtkStyleProviders. Style providers
 | 
						||
 * can be either attached explicitly to the context through
 | 
						||
 * gtk_style_context_add_provider(), or to the screen through
 | 
						||
 * gtk_style_context_add_provider_for_screen(). The resulting style is a
 | 
						||
 * combination of all providers’ information in priority order.
 | 
						||
 *
 | 
						||
 * For GTK+ widgets, any #GtkStyleContext returned by
 | 
						||
 * gtk_widget_get_style_context() will already have a #GtkWidgetPath, a
 | 
						||
 * #GdkScreen and RTL/LTR information set. The style context will be also
 | 
						||
 * updated automatically if any of these settings change on the widget.
 | 
						||
 *
 | 
						||
 * If you are using the theming layer standalone, you will need to set a
 | 
						||
 * widget path and a screen yourself to the created style context through
 | 
						||
 * gtk_style_context_set_path() and gtk_style_context_set_screen(), as well
 | 
						||
 * as updating the context yourself using gtk_style_context_invalidate()
 | 
						||
 * whenever any of the conditions change, such as a change in the
 | 
						||
 * #GtkSettings:gtk-theme-name setting or a hierarchy change in the rendered
 | 
						||
 * widget.
 | 
						||
 *
 | 
						||
 * # Style Classes # {#gtkstylecontext-classes}
 | 
						||
 *
 | 
						||
 * Widgets can add style classes to their context, which can be used
 | 
						||
 * to associate different styles by class
 | 
						||
 * (see [Selectors][gtkcssprovider-selectors]).
 | 
						||
 *
 | 
						||
 * # Style Regions
 | 
						||
 *
 | 
						||
 * Widgets can also add regions with flags to their context. This feature is
 | 
						||
 * deprecated and will be removed in a future GTK+ update. Please use style
 | 
						||
 * classes instead.
 | 
						||
 *
 | 
						||
 * The regions used by GTK+ widgets are:
 | 
						||
 *
 | 
						||
 * ## row
 | 
						||
 * Used by #GtkTreeView. Can be used with the flags: `even`, `odd`.
 | 
						||
 *
 | 
						||
 * ## column
 | 
						||
 * Used by #GtkTreeView. Can be used with the flags: `first`, `last`, `sorted`.
 | 
						||
 *
 | 
						||
 * ## column-header
 | 
						||
 * Used by #GtkTreeView.
 | 
						||
 *
 | 
						||
 * ## tab
 | 
						||
 * Used by #GtkNotebook. Can be used with the flags: `even`, `odd`, `first`, `last`.
 | 
						||
 *
 | 
						||
 * # Custom styling in UI libraries and applications
 | 
						||
 *
 | 
						||
 * If you are developing a library with custom #GtkWidgets that
 | 
						||
 * render differently than standard components, you may need to add a
 | 
						||
 * #GtkStyleProvider yourself with the %GTK_STYLE_PROVIDER_PRIORITY_FALLBACK
 | 
						||
 * priority, either a #GtkCssProvider or a custom object implementing the
 | 
						||
 * #GtkStyleProvider interface. This way themes may still attempt
 | 
						||
 * to style your UI elements in a different way if needed so.
 | 
						||
 *
 | 
						||
 * If you are using custom styling on an applications, you probably want then
 | 
						||
 * to make your style information prevail to the theme’s, so you must use
 | 
						||
 * a #GtkStyleProvider with the %GTK_STYLE_PROVIDER_PRIORITY_APPLICATION
 | 
						||
 * priority, keep in mind that the user settings in
 | 
						||
 * `XDG_CONFIG_HOME/gtk-3.0/gtk.css` will
 | 
						||
 * still take precedence over your changes, as it uses the
 | 
						||
 * %GTK_STYLE_PROVIDER_PRIORITY_USER priority.
 | 
						||
 */
